Output 33a98df73abbb40b5f7763e9d722bed54df00a91cc6031e9da5f4b5d49f7a807:35

value
365626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ebefe3ea4a088e7638e79454884ec20da6b62c OP_EQUAL
address
36szQUsba3r4SwLFAGanrZSLGcoAZznwr6
transaction
33a98df73abbb40b5f7763e9d722bed54df00a91cc6031e9da5f4b5d49f7a807
confirmations
213317
spent
true